Kyle Charles Calder, passed away on June 15, 2026, in Lake Forest, Illinois, surrounded by his family at the age of 47 years.
Kyle was born on January 5, 1979 in Mannville, Alberta, Canada.
Kyle was the beloved husband of Lindsey Stice; a loving father to his children, Kayden, Madison and Ryker Calder, and CJ and Rylan Stice. He was the cherished son of Bill and Dianne Calder; dear brother of Ryan (Suzy) Calder and Jill (Chris) McDavid; and favourite uncle of Brooke and Jace McDavid and Penelope and Zoe Calder. Also grieving his loss is his California family: his parents in-law, Tracy & John Stice; his sister’s in law, Jessica Buckley with her children Brooklyn and Avalon, Tiffany (Ryan) Rankin and with their daughter Selah, and Taylor (Rob) Marienthal with their children, Sage and Rocco. He is also missed by his grandmothers-in-law, Pat Stice and Bev Connolly; as well as many loving aunts, uncles, cousins, extended family members, and dear friends.
